إنشاء نظام مجموعات Apache Hadoop في Azure HDInsight باستخدام قالب Azure Resource Manager

في هذه المقالة، ستتعلم عدة طرق لإنشاء مجموعات Azure HDInsight باستخدام قوالب Azure Resource Manager. للتعرف على ميزات وأدوات إنشاء المجموعات الأخرى، انقر فوق محدد علامة التبويب أعلى هذه الصفحة. راجع أيضًا، طرق إنشاء المجموعة.

تحذير

يتم تحديد فوترة مجموعات HDInsight في الدقيقة، سواء كنت تستخدمها أم لا. تأكد من حذف نظام المجموعة بعد انتهائك من استخدامه. تعرف على كيفية حذف مجموعة HDInsight.

قوالب Azure Resource Manager

يسهل قالب Resource Manager إنشاء الموارد التالية لتطبيقك في عملية واحدة منسقة:

  • مجموعات HDInsight والموارد التابعة لها (مثل حساب التخزين الافتراضي).
  • موارد أخرى (مثل قاعدة بيانات Azure SQL لاستخدام Apache Sqoop).

في القالب، تُحدّد الموارد اللازمة للتطبيق. يمكنك أيضًا تحديد معلمات النشر لقيم الإدخال لبيئات مختلفة. يتكون القالب من JSON والتعبيرات التي تستخدمها لتكوين قيم للنشر الخاص بك.

يمكنك العثور على عينات لنماذج HDInsight في قوالب التشغيل السريع من Azure. استخدم Visual Studio Code عبر الأنظمة الأساسية مع ملحق Resource Manager أو محرر نصي لحفظ القالب في ملف على محطة العمل الخاصة بك.

للحصول على مزيدٍ من المعلومات عن قوالب إدارة الموارد، راجع المقالات والأمثلة التالية:

إنشاء قوالب

يمكّنك Resource Manager من تصدير قالب Resource Manager من الموارد الموجودة في اشتراكك باستخدام أدوات مختلفة. يمكنك استخدام هذا القالب الذي تم إنشاؤه للتعرف على بنية القالب أو لأتمتة إعادة نشر الحل الخاص بك حسب الحاجة. للحصول على مزيدٍ من المعلومات، راجع تصدير القوالب.

توزيع باستخدام المدخل

يمكنك نشر قالب Resource Manager باستخدام مدخل Azure. للحصول على مزيدٍ من المعلومات، راجع نشر الموارد من قالب مخصص.

توزيع باستخدام PowerShell

يمكنك نشر قالب إدارة الموارد باستخدام Azure PowerShell. للحصول على مزيدٍ من المعلومات، راجع نشر الموارد باستخدام قوالب إدارة الموارد وAzure PowerShell ونشر قالب مدير الموارد الخاص باستخدام رمز SAS المميز وAzure PowerShell.

التوزيع باستخدام Azure CLI

يمكنك نشر قالب إدارة الموارد باستخدام Azure CLI. للحصول على مزيدٍ من المعلومات، راجع نشر الموارد باستخدام قوالب إدارة الموارد وAzure CLI ونشر قالب مدير الموارد الخاص باستخدام رمز SAS المميز وAzure CLI.

النشر باستخدام REST API

يمكنك نشر قالب إدارة الموارد باستخدام REST API. للحصول على مزيدٍ من المعلومات، راجع نشر الموارد باستخدام قوالب Resource Manager وResource Manager REST API.

النشر باستخدام Visual Studio

استخدم Visual Studio لإنشاء مشروع مجموعة موارد ونشره في Azure من خلال واجهة المستخدم. حدد نوع الموارد المراد تضمينها في مشروعك. تتم إضافة هذه الموارد تلقائيًا إلى قالب إدارة الموارد. يوفر المشروع أيضًا برنامج نصي PowerShell لنشر القالب.

للحصول على مقدمة عن استخدام Visual Studio مع مجموعات الموارد، راجع إنشاء مجموعات موارد Azure ونشرها من خلال Visual Studio.

استكشاف الأخطاء وإصلاحها

إذا واجهت مشكلات في إنشاء مجموعات HDInsight، فراجع متطلبات التحكم في الوصول.

الخطوات التالية

في هذه المقالة، تعلمت عدة طرق لإنشاء مجموعة HDInsight. لمعرفة المزيد، راجع المقالات التالية: